blink |
to close and open the eyes very quickly. |
builder |
a person who puts things together to make something, especially houses or other structures that people live or work in. |
dawn |
the first light of day that appears in the morning. |
eyesight |
the ability to see; vision. |
frighten |
to cause fear in someone; to make someone afraid. |
lead1 |
to direct someone; guide. |
likely |
to be expected; probable. |
race1 |
a sport or test of speed. |
recycle |
to put used things through a process that allows them to be used again. |
slope |
A surface that is higher on one end than the other. |
surprise |
to suddenly do something (to someone) that is not at all expected. |
talk |
to communicate by speaking. |
task |
a piece of work to be done; duty. |
tube |
a long, hollow piece of glass, metal, or rubber used to hold or carry liquids or gases. |
uncle |
the brother of one's father or mother, or the husband of one's aunt. |
